George Harrison Documentary Preview
. Scorsese says of Harrison's importance: "George was making spiritually awake music. We all heard and felt it � and I think that was the reason he came to occupy a very special place in our lives." The documentary looks at George Harrison's life from humble beginnings in Liverpool to global superstardom and includes interviews with many of Harrison's closest friends.
